Water the flowers directly from the riverYou cannot use river water directly to water flowers. You need to dry the river water for 1-2 days before using it, because river water contains more microorganisms, such as wild fish, toad eggs, rotten crabs, and some underwater insect eggs. These are invisible to our naked eyes. If you use river water directly to water flowers, it will affect the growth of flowers. The pros and cons of watering flowers with river waterRiver water is the water closest to nature. It contains minerals needed by flowers in high concentrations. It is helpful for the growth of flowers and can provide them with nutrients. At the same time, river water also helps the growth and development of flower roots, but because river water contains a large number of bacteria and microorganisms, it may cause an increase in the number of pathogens in the soil and lead to root diseases.
